多重签名钱包的原理与应用:区块链安全的新时

    时间:2025-03-08 00:54:51

    主页 > 加密动态 >

                在数字货币和区块链技术日益成熟的今天,钱包的安全性显得尤为重要。多重签名钱包这种概念,因其能够有效增强资产的安全性,受到越来越多人的关注。那么,多重签名钱包的原理是什么?其如何实现资产的保护?在以下内容中,我们将详细探讨多重签名钱包的原理,以及其在实际应用中的优势与潜在问题。

                一、多重签名钱包的基本原理

                多重签名钱包(Multi-Signature Wallet)是一种含有多个公钥的数字钱包,只有当多个私钥联合签名时,才能进行交易。这种机制相较于传统的单一签名钱包,提供了更高的安全性并防止单点故障。

                具体来说,多重签名钱包的原理可以用如下几个要素来说明:

                1. 公钥与私钥的组合:在多重签名钱包中,多个用户的公钥会被聚合在一起形成一个钱包地址,这个钱包地址可以接收数字货币。但是,转出数字货币时需要多个私钥进行签名。
                2. 阈值签名机制:多重签名钱包通常会设定一个阈值,比如2-of-3,即需要3个签名者中的2个签名才能完成一笔交易。这种设置使得即使其中一把私钥丢失,也不会导致资产不可用。
                3. 智能合约的应用:在很多区块链平台上,多重签名钱包是通过智能合约实现的。智能合约定义了何种情况下可以进行资产转移,从而确保达成预先设定的共识。

                二、多重签名钱包的工作流程

                多重签名钱包的工作流程可以分为以下几步:

                1. 创建钱包: 用户首先创建一个多重签名钱包,并确定参与者和各自的公钥和私钥。这一步骤中,用户还需要设定阈值,比如需要2个或3个签名才能完成交易。
                2. 生成共享地址: 通过聚合所有参与者的公钥,生成一个多重签名地址。这个地址即为用户可以用来接收数字货币的地址。
                3. 发起交易: 当需要进行资产转移时,发起交易的用户需要创建一笔交易,并发送给其他签名者。
                4. 签名过程: 每位参与者使用自己的私钥对交易进行签名,只有当达到设定的阈值时,交易才能被执行。
                5. 广播交易: 最后,经过验证的交易被广播到区块链网络,等待矿工打包并确认。

                三、多重签名钱包的优势

                多重签名钱包有诸多优势,使其在数字时代备受推崇:

                1. 增强安全性:由于需要多个私钥进行签名,单个密钥丢失或被盗的风险显著降低。即使某一参与者的密钥被黑客获取,资产仍然安全。
                2. 防止内部欺诈:在公司或组织中,多重签名机制可以避免单个管理者对资金的独断专行。需要多个高管签名才能进行大额交易,增强了财务透明度。
                3. 易于管理:用户可以自由设定签名者的数量以及所需的阈值,灵活应对不同场景下的资产管理需求。
                4. 支持去中心化:多重签名钱包不依赖于单一服务提供方,即使某个节点失效,其他节点依然能够确保钱包的正常运作。

                四、多重签名钱包的应用场景

                多重签名钱包的应用场景非常广泛,特别在以下几种情况下表现尤为出色:

                1. 企业财务管理:对于公司来说,财务透明性非常重要。通过多重签名钱包,可以设置高管团队需要联合签字才能进行资本转移,防止内部人员的滥用行为。
                2. 基金管理:在多个投资方共同托管资产的场景中,多重签名钱包可以保证所有方的权益,防止因某一方的失误或欺诈行为造成整体损失。
                3. 家族财富管理:在家族财产传承中,多重签名可以保障财产安全,同时也保证了多位家族成员的共同决策权。
                4. DAO(去中心化自治组织):在很多去中心化组织中,多重签名钱包使得组织成员可以共同管理和控制资金,增强了去中心化的信任机制。

                五、常见问题解答

                1. 多重签名钱包在安全性上有哪些缺陷和漏洞?

                虽然多重签名钱包在安全性上较传统钱包有诸多优势,但也并非完美无缺,仍然存在一些安全隐患:

                1. 用户管理的不当:在多重签名的钱包中,私钥的管理极其重要。如果某个参与者未能妥善管理自己的私钥,可能会导致资产的潜在风险。如果某人因疏忽而丢失了自己的私钥,这将影响到其他共同持有者,因为他们需要一同签名以完成交易。
                2. 社交工程攻击:黑客可能通过伪装或社交工程方式,试图获得某个参与者的私钥。一旦黑客获取到某个参与者的私钥,虽然并不能立即转移资产,但可以尝试引导其他参与者进行不安全的操作,造成损失。
                3. 代币合约的安全漏洞:如果多重签名钱包的智能合约本身存在漏洞,黑客可以利用这些漏洞进行攻击。这要求开发团队在编写智能合约时要特别小心,经过充分测试和审查。
                4. 复杂性管理: 多重签名钱包相对复杂,对于不懂技术的用户而言,可能会犯错,或者理解上产生误解,甚至在日常使用中因流程复杂而影响到交易的及时性和顺利性。

                2. 如何选择和配置多重签名钱包?

                在选购和配置多重签名钱包时,用户应考虑以下几个方面:

                1. 支持的币种:首先需要确认该钱包是否支持你需要存储和管理的数字货币。如果你计划成为一个多币种用户,则寻找支持多种币种的钱包将是一个好的选择。
                2. 安全性与审计:钱包的开发团队是否有良好的声誉和背景,国家监管或者行业协会的认证。强烈建议选择那些经过充分审计和持续维护的钱包,以避免潜在的安全问题。
                3. 用户友好性:一个好的多重签名钱包应该简单易用,尤其是在设置多方签章的时候;对于普通用户,复杂的设定与管理流程会造成使用上的困难,影响资产操作的便利性。
                4. 社区和支持:选择那些有活跃社区支持的钱包,如果遇到问题,是否有足够的资源和途径解决疑难。在使用多重签名钱包的过程中,用户应该可以获得适时的帮助。

                3. 多重签名钱包未来的发展趋势是什么?

                随着区块链技术的不断发展和完善,多重签名钱包的未来有以下几个趋势:

                1. 跨链支持:未来的多重签名钱包将可能支持不同区块链平台的资产,通过跨链技术使得用户可以进行多方签名的简化。这将极大增强用户的便利性。
                2. 与 DeFi 的深度整合:随着去中心化金融(DeFi)愈加成熟,多重签名钱包将可能和 DeFi 协议深度结合,用户可能通过多重签名的方式更好地参与 DeFi 项目,同时管理他们的资产。
                3. 用户体验的持续:为了迎合普通用户的使用需求,未来多重签名钱包的界面和操作流程将会越来越友好,以更好地教育用户如何安全地管理他们的数字资产。
                4. 合规性加强:在监管日益严格的环境下,多重签名钱包会越来越考虑合规性问题,在交易和管理中引入身份认证及其他合规性规章,让用户在保护隐私与符合法规之间找到平衡。

                通过以上内容的详细解析,相信您对多重签名钱包的原理、优势、应用以及相关问题有了更深入的了解。随着技术的发展,这种钱包的安全性和便利性将不断提升,为数字资产的安全保驾护航。